NASCAR Camping World East Series racer Kristin Bumbera has parted ways with Bobby Hamilton Jr. Racing after this past weekend's event at South Boston Speedway. Speed51.com confirmed on Wednesday with Cheri Bumbera, Kristin's business representative, that they are now looking to race in the NASCAR Camping World West Series with their own team based out of Texas, Next Generation Racing. They are currently looking for marketing partners for the season and can be contacted through Kristin's website by clicking here.
Also, Late Model Racer Tiff Daniels will be making her NASCAR Camping World East Series debut at Watkins Glen International (NY) on Saturday, June 6th, according to her website. Daniels, who is a Support Engineer with Earnhardt Ganassi Racing, will race in her first-career road course race on Saturday. It is expected she will drive the Bobby Hamilton Jr Racing Dodge that has been vacated by Bumbera.
